About the Author

Mir Rahimi is a passionate advocate for peace, justice and human rights. Born in Afghanistan and arriving in the UK as a refugee in 2001, he began formal education at fourteen and went on to earn a master’s degree in political theory from the London School of Economics and Political Science (LSE) in 2011.
Since then, Mir has worked with charities, local authorities, international NGOs, and the United Nations across continents—including in Africa, Australia, Europe, the Middle East and the UK to support vulnerable communities particularly displaced children in crisis. He has also spoken at leading global forums, including the UN High Commissioner’s Dialogue in Geneva and the UN Annual Conference in Copenhagen, advocating for peace, justice and the protection of children in conflict zones and in displacement.
He is the founder of Edu-Change, a UK-based charity that empowers young people from displaced and disadvantaged backgrounds to succeed in education, develop leadership skills, and become agents of peace, inclusion, and positive change within their communities and beyond.
